READ MOREGas cutting technology is a process that uses high-temperature combustion or plasma streams to cut metals, and it is widely used in manufacturing, maintenance, construction, and other industries. Compared with other cutting methods, gas cutting has the advantages of flexible equipment, convenient operation, and a wide range of applications.
Gas cutting refers to a process that uses a mixture of oxygen and combustible gases (such as acetylene, liquefied petroleum gas, natural gas, etc.) to produce a high-temperature flame, heating the metal to its melting point and cutting it quickly. Based on the cutting method, gas cutting mainly includes two types: oxy-fuel cutting and plasma cutting.
Gas cutting products include not only cutting equipment but also gases, gas regulating accessories, nozzles, torches, and safety devices, which are key factors in ensuring cutting efficiency and quality.
Nozzles and torches are components that are in direct contact with the flame during the gas cutting process, and their quality and design significantly affect the cutting effect.
The gas supply system is a core component of gas cutting, including gas cylinders, regulators, pipelines, and flow control devices. Proper configuration and use of the supply system are essential for ensuring smooth cutting operations.
Gas cutting accessories play a crucial role in improving cutting efficiency and operational safety. Common accessories include flame ignition devices, protective equipment, support tables, and guiding devices.
Modern gas cutting processes are increasingly reliant on machine tools and automated equipment to achieve high precision and mass production.
Gas cutting involves risks such as high-temperature flames, flammable gases, and metal splashes, so safety measures are crucial.
Good daily maintenance is an important part of extending the life of gas cutting products and ensuring cutting quality.
Gas cutting products play an indispensable role in modern metal processing. From nozzles and torches to gas supply systems and safety accessories, every component directly affects cutting performance and operational safety. The scientific selection, proper maintenance, and standardized operation of gas cutting products can not only improve work efficiency but also extend equipment life and ensure stable and reliable cutting operations.
